This past Friday, March 27, 2026, an incident unfolded that reignited concerns surrounding the greatest golfer of all time, Tiger Woods. Once again, he became involved in a major situation away from the golf course.
Woods was part of an accident in which his car ended up overturned, all while he was under the influence of prohibited substances, leading to a DUI arrest. Regarding the matter, veteran golfer Mark Lye hopes the consequences will not be limited to legal repercussions, but extend onto the course as well.
The harsh punishment Mark Lye is calling for Tiger Woods
There is a saying that greatness and character endure until the very end, and it applies well to Tiger Woods. He remains the ultimate reference point in golf, yet his behavior off the course has often left much to be desired.
First domino should be to take Tiger’s name off LA Open Genisis…not a good look. Next, the Hero. As a former player myself, as well as broadcaster, I couldn’t even show my face again. His kids will suffer as well, shameful and selfish.
Mark Lye wrote in an X post and added.
I don’t like sugar-coating things, and the way I look at it, there’s got to be some sort of punishment or withdrawal or some sort of suspension from the game.
The accident involving Woods included his vehicle, a Land Rover, which collided with a truck and ultimately flipped over. The incident occurred near Woods’ residence. Fortunately, there were no injuries, but it once again sparked criticism regarding dangerous driving.
Although Tiger’s breathalyzer test registered 0%, he refused to take a urine test, which ultimately resulted in his DUI arrest.
He spent eight hours in custody, as required by law for this type of incident. He was released around 11:15 p.m., and a car picked him up to take him home.
Lye is now calling for Woods to be removed as host of the Genesis International and the World Hero Challenge, as well as from his role as chair of the Future Competition Committee.
The severity of the punishment Lye is requesting stems from the belief that Woods’ actions could negatively influence others, especially given what transpired last Friday. It is also worth recalling that in May 2017, Woods was found asleep in his car and was similarly arrested on suspicion of DUI.
At that time, toxicology reports revealed the presence of five prescription medications in his system. Woods pleaded guilty to reckless driving, paid a $250 fine, and was required to participate in a 12-month program.
The PGA enforces strict penalties for members who violate alcohol or conduct policies, but these typically apply only during active participation in a tournament. Since this was not the case, the PGA has limited authority to act.
On the other hand, while Lye is demanding severe punishment, others have expressed their support for Woods.
One of them was Anthony Kim, who has also dealt with similar incidents in the past and, after overcoming them, found the strength to return even stronger.
Dunno wat @tigerwoods is dealin w & it isn’t my business. As some1 who has & will always deal w my own issues like every other human I pray the man who positively influenced my life and millions of others overcomes wat he is going thru. Trust GOD 1% BETTER SOBER is DOPE.
Kim wrote about the Tiger Woods incident in an X post.
